Output ffbb60d384593157064ad418245345c1f5832f4a3c1e4f1d871cc57d9116a586:28

value
559563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35b4a6057dbf4732c6aca1d28c09b7cdeab973b3 OP_EQUAL
address
36az9PaTBFfUTnPcWAbGJcLqvVScEdkPLu
transaction
ffbb60d384593157064ad418245345c1f5832f4a3c1e4f1d871cc57d9116a586
spent
true